A combination of a phenomenal organising team, a breath taking Adriaticâ€‘sea setting, and an exceptional breadth of content spanning the full MS Business Applications stack from Powerâ€¯Apps, Businessâ€¯Central, Finance &amp;amp; Operations, and beyond.&amp;nbsp;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div&gt;&lt;div&gt;Held in PortoroÅ¾, Slovenia, in a fairy-taleâ€‘like convention centre overlooking the Adriatic Sea, DynamicsMinds 2025 brought over 1,000 attendees, more than 200 sessions, close to 200 speakers, and 80+ MVPs into one vibrant, communityâ€‘powered gathering.&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div&gt;Beyond the sessions, the charm of Dynamics Minds lies in its atmosphere of warm hospitality and the openness of fellow participants giving a unique sense of camaraderie.&lt;/div&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div&gt;&lt;h3 style="text-align: left;"&gt;Here is a short summary of my talks&lt;/h3&gt;&lt;h4 style="text-align: left;"&gt;The 4 Pillars Of BC To PP Integration - together with&amp;nbsp;&lt;a href="https://www.linkedin.com/in/phil-kermeen/"&gt;Phil Kermeen&lt;/a&gt;&lt;/h4&gt;&lt;div&gt;In this session we had a high level look through a number of integration techniques, starting with a simple lo-code approach and ranging up through Virtual Tables, BC Data Sync and onto Calling the API in code, giving you the reasoning behind why you'd want to use the various techniques.&amp;nbsp;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;h4 style="text-align: left;"&gt;What I learned&amp;nbsp;&lt;/h4&gt;&lt;div&gt;This was the 3rd and final time giving this introductory level 101 session; as we were on the last day attendance was a bit thin on the ground - non-the less some good post talk chat was had!&am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;h4 style="text-align: left;"&gt;Page Scripting Tool for Acceptance Testing - - together with&amp;nbsp;&lt;a href="https://www.linkedin.com/in/josemiguelazevedo/"&gt;Jose Miguel Azevedo&lt;/a&gt;&lt;/h4&gt;&lt;div&gt;&lt;div&gt;In this session we showed how the page scripting tool in the Business Central web client lets users record interactions with the user interface (UI), such as opening pages, selecting actions and filling in fields. We went on to look at how can then replay the recording to show the exact actions in the UI and as the recording is replayed, how you receive real-time status feedback for success or failure.&lt;/div&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div&gt;&lt;b&gt;What I learned&lt;/b&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div&gt;This was also on the last day, in the last session of the day! Better to leave the door locked and provide access only when required, so long as you (the client organisation) have suitable coverage with you internal IT resource/team to let the partners in when necessary.&amp;nbsp;&lt;/p&gt;</description></item><item><title>Give me Dynamics 365 BC approvals with auto-delegation driven by Outlook Out-of-Office</title><link>https://blog.wingate365.com/2024/11/give-me-dynamics-365-bc-approvals-with.html</link><pubDate>Sun, 10 Nov 2024 16:48:00 +0000</pubDate><guid>https://blog.wingate365.com/2024/11/give-me-dynamics-365-bc-approvals-with.html</guid><description>&lt;p&gt;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;p&gt;&amp;nbsp;This is something I'm asked on most projects when we get to the topic of approvals.&lt;/p&gt;&lt;p&gt;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;p&gt;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;ul style="text-align: left;"&gt;&lt;li&gt;Client: "WOW these BC approval workflows look good, and I expect the approval will be automatically delegated if the user has their outlook out-of-office on, right?"&lt;/li&gt;&lt;li&gt;Me: "About that..."&lt;/li&gt;&lt;/ul&gt;&lt;div&gt;Contina does a good effort on managing out-of-office&amp;nbsp;&lt;a href="https://docs.continia.com/en-us/continia-document-capture/setting-up-document-capture/setting-up-document-approval/approval-sharing"&gt;Setting up Approval Sharing&lt;/a&gt;, but it's a config that's inside BC, and it doesn't cover all document types.&amp;nbsp;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div&gt;Most users simply &lt;b&gt;expect &lt;/b&gt;out-of-office to be something you setup once in outlook and it's shared to all the other MS apps.&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div&gt;I've confessed in the past that I rather use BC approvals over Power Automate approvals. Possibly that's driven by me simply being able to setup and test anything from simple to big hairy approvals in BC a lot faster than in PA.&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div&gt;Yes, there is an automatic delegation in BC workflows. It works on a count down, it will auto delegate after x many days. But it is very rarely used, if ever. Why? Consider the real word situation. Someone asked you to approve something, but you can't right away. Could be a number of reasons why; you need to look something up, check with someone who is away etc etc. Maybe you just need to sit on it for a bit. The last thing you want is the approval going to someone else in these situations!&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div&gt;To solve the problem above I wanted to take a blended approach; use BC for the approvals and PA for its low-code access to Exchange Online / Outlook for the out of office status of a user.&lt;/div&gt;&lt;h2 style="text-align: left;"&gt;Solution&lt;/h2&gt;&lt;div&gt;&lt;ul style="text-align: left;"&gt;&lt;li&gt;Create Approval workflow of any kind in BC &lt;b&gt;[Config]&lt;/b&gt;&lt;/li&gt;&lt;ul&gt;&lt;li&gt;&lt;a href="https://learn.microsoft.com/en-gb/dynamics365/business-central/across-set-up-workflows"&gt;Set up approval workflows - Business Central | Microsoft Learn&lt;/a&gt;&lt;/li&gt;&lt;/ul&gt;&lt;li&gt;Create API query for approval entries &amp;amp; users emails&amp;nbsp;&lt;b&gt;[AL code]&lt;/b&gt;&lt;/li&gt;&lt;ul&gt;&lt;li&gt;&lt;a href="https://yzhums.com/57475/"&gt;Dynamics 365 Business Central: API query type (Develop a custom API using Query) | Dynamics 365 Lab&lt;/a&gt;&lt;/li&gt;&lt;/ul&gt;&lt;li&gt;Create API page for the 'delegate' action as an OData bound action &lt;b&gt;[AL code]&amp;nbsp;&lt;/b&gt;&lt;/li&gt;&lt;ul&gt;&lt;li&gt;&lt;a href="https://yzhums.com/39196/"&gt;Dynamics 365 Business Central: How to use Standard/Custom API Bound Actions | Dynamics 365 Lab&lt;/a&gt;&lt;/li&gt;&lt;/ul&gt;&lt;li&gt;Create a PA flow that checks the Outlook Out-of-Office status of the approver of open approval entries and delegates these &lt;b&gt;[Low-code]&lt;/b&gt;&lt;/li&gt;&lt;ul&gt;&lt;li&gt;&lt;a href="https://tldr-dynamics.com/blog/check-ooo-power-automate"&gt;tldr-dynamics | Check user's out of office status using Power Automate&lt;/a&gt;&lt;/li&gt;&lt;li&gt;&lt;b&gt;And this thank you FlowJoe!&amp;nbsp;&lt;/b&gt;&lt;a href="https://www.youtube.com/watch?app=desktop&amp;amp;v=wtWn8XpmGys"&gt;Easily Avoid Apply to Each Loops | Power Automate&lt;/a&gt;&lt;/li&gt;&lt;/ul&gt;&lt;/ul&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div&gt;The key part here was to have PA fetch only the open approval entries and then loop though and only delegate those where the approval user was sending automatic replies / had set out-of-office.&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div&gt;This solution was put together with help from my good buddy Lee Noble who sorted the code for the OData bound action. Thank you Lee!&lt;/div&gt;&lt;h3 style="text-align: left;"&gt;BC Approval&lt;/h3&gt;&lt;div&gt;I've kept it simple in this example, but because the delegation simply works based on approval entries created it should work for any kind of approval you (or you customers) dream up!&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div&gt;I've used the standard template for Purchase Order approval (because it takes only a few clicks to active)!&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;table align="center" cellpadding="0" cellspacing="0" class="tr-caption-container" style="margin-left: auto; margin-right: auto;"&gt;&lt;tbody&gt;&lt;tr&gt;&lt;td style="text-align: center;"&gt;&lt;a href="https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/img/b/R29vZ2xl/AVvXsEhhvkI4Judw7ikZjYIH-IV_kmpBlCeHfYv2Ld1P04r5CkQN28P2HCMTf29dx0nfeNHVxYb6HMJ3A3GWXz3nhnEXrmA3H5Yasod28Fu2WuPk7fMEtEFibho9loxN5LmrHhOCrXFEbLoVoxBo3PN4ovXdKTw58VhdUiED7_rxMcxDdsPfYUTE0mA2/s1743/2024-11-10_10h26_09.png" style="margin-left: auto; margin-right: auto;"&gt;&lt;img border="0" data-original-height="787" data-original-width="1743" height="288" src="https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/img/b/R29vZ2xl/AVvXsEhhvkI4Judw7ikZjYIH-IV_kmpBlCeHfYv2Ld1P04r5CkQN28P2HCMTf29dx0nfeNHVxYb6HMJ3A3GWXz3nhnEXrmA3H5Yasod28Fu2WuPk7fMEtEFibho9loxN5LmrHhOCrXFEbLoVoxBo3PN4ovXdKTw58VhdUiED7_rxMcxDdsPfYUTE0mA2/w640-h288/2024-11-10_10h26_09.png" width="640" /&gt;&lt;/a&gt;&lt;/td&gt;&lt;/tr&gt;&lt;tr&gt;&lt;td class="tr-caption" style="text-align: center;"&gt;Vanilla PO Approval from the standard template&lt;/td&gt;&lt;/tr&gt;&lt;/tbody&gt;&lt;/table&gt;&lt;div&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div&gt;Bare bones approval user setup - just to highlight a few important points. As you may know only the Approval Admin can delegate 'anything' so be sure to create the PA flow that's going to be doing delegating in the name of that account.&amp;nbsp;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div&gt;It's possible that the OData bound / API calling of 'delegate' wont have the same restriction, but I've yet to test that.&am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div&gt;&lt;p&gt;&lt;/p&gt;</description></item><item><title>Dynamics 365 Business Central - Page Part Terms - Updated for 2024 Q4</title><link>https://blog.wingate365.com/2024/10/dynamics-365-business-central-page-part.html</link><pubDate>Wed, 16 Oct 2024 08:24:00 +0000</pubDate><guid>https://blog.wingate365.com/2024/10/dynamics-365-business-central-page-part.html</guid><description>&lt;p&gt;Something that I am always keen to engage with on projects is the business language.
